Taro Logo

Formal Verification Engineer, Platform IP

Google organizes the world's information and makes it universally accessible and useful, combining AI, Software, and Hardware to create helpful experiences.
Backend
Mid-Level Software Engineer
In-Person
5,000+ Employees
3+ years of experience
Enterprise SaaS

Description For Formal Verification Engineer, Platform IP

Google is seeking a Formal Verification Engineer to join their Platform IP team, focusing on developing custom silicon solutions that power Google's direct-to-consumer products. This role combines hardware expertise with software development, requiring strong skills in formal verification methodologies and programming.

The position involves working with cutting-edge technology at one of the world's leading tech companies, where you'll contribute to innovations that impact millions of users worldwide. You'll be responsible for ensuring the reliability and correctness of hardware designs through formal verification techniques, including sequential equivalence checking, security path verification, and connectivity verification.

The ideal candidate will have a strong background in electrical engineering or computer science, with specific expertise in formal verification tools and methodologies. You'll work with various formal verification applications and contribute to improving verification processes through enhanced methodologies and scripting.

This role offers the opportunity to work on challenging technical problems at scale, collaborating with teams that combine the best of Google's AI, Software, and Hardware capabilities. You'll be part of Google's mission to organize the world's information and make it universally accessible and useful, while working on hardware solutions that push the boundaries of what's possible in consumer technology.

The position requires both technical expertise and the ability to work effectively in a collaborative environment, contributing to Google's next generation of hardware experiences. You'll be involved in creating solutions that deliver unparalleled performance, efficiency, and integration, making this an excellent opportunity for someone passionate about hardware verification and innovation.

Last updated 6 days ago

Responsibilities For Formal Verification Engineer, Platform IP

  • Plan the formal verification strategy, create the properties and constraints for digital design blocks
  • Use different formal verification applications to resolve multiple tests like clock-gating verification, low power, connectivity and security path verification
  • Utilize formal property verification tools combined with formal verification closure techniques to verify properties
  • Contribute improvements to methodologies and scripting to enhance formal verification results

Requirements For Formal Verification Engineer, Platform IP

Python
  • Bachelor's degree in Electrical Engineering, Computer Science, or equivalent practical experience
  • 3 years of experience with Formal Verification
  • Experience with programming languages (e.g., Python/Perl and TCL)
  • Experience with regression setup and management
  • Experience with formal sign-offs of industry Application-specific integrated circuit (ASIC) designs
  • Knowledge of formal verification applications
  • Knowledge of formal methodology and formal abstraction techniques

Interested in this job?

Jobs Related To Google Formal Verification Engineer, Platform IP